Cornyn brings in $2.5m in Q1

News: Sen. John Cornyn (R-Texas) raised nearly $2.5 million in the first quarter of 2025, bringing his total cash on hand to $5.7 million.

The news comes as Cornyn, who has long been a powerhouse fundraiser for Senate Republicans, is facing what is certain to be an expensive primary campaign against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ton this week.

Paxton announced his campaign against Cornyn earlier this week. Paxton told us last month that he’d need to raise at least $20 million to knock off Cornyn, who has the backing of the NRSC, the Senate Leadership Fund and Senate GOP leadership.

Running a campaign in the sprawling Lone Star State is notoriously pricey. So each candidate will need every dollar they can get.

Two Texas House Republicans — Reps. Lance Gooden and Troy Nehls — have already endorsed Paxton, while Sen. Ted Cruz (R-Texas) is staying neutral in the race.
